{"product_id":"conquering-javascript-d3js-9781032411705","title":"Conquering JavaScript: D3.js","description":"\u003cp\u003e\u003c\/p\u003e\u003cblockquote\u003e\n\u003cbr\u003eThe course provides industry-specific case-based examples, discusses the visual implementation of d3.js for project work, and emphasizes writing clean and maintainable code. \u003c\/blockquote\u003e\u003cp\u003e\u003cstrong\u003eFormat\u003c\/strong\u003e: Paperback \/ softback\u003cbr\u003e\u003cstrong\u003eLength\u003c\/strong\u003e: 204 pages\u003cbr\u003e\u003cstrong\u003ePublication date\u003c\/strong\u003e: 08 August 2023\u003cbr\u003e\u003cstrong\u003ePublisher\u003c\/strong\u003e: Taylor \u0026amp; Francis Ltd\u003cbr\u003e\u003c\/p\u003e \u003cp\u003e\u003cbr\u003eD3.js is a powerful data visualization library that allows users to create interactive and visually stunning charts, graphs, and maps. It provides a wide range of features and tools that enable users to manipulate and analyze data in a variety of ways.\u003cbr\u003eD3.js is a versatile and powerful data visualization library that empowers users to create interactive and visually captivating charts, graphs, and maps. With its extensive range of features and tools, it enables users to manipulate and analyze data in diverse ways, making it an invaluable tool for data scientists, analysts, and developers alike.\u003cbr\u003e\u003cbr\u003eOne of the key strengths of D3.js is its ability to provide industry-specific case-based examples. This allows users to gain a deeper understanding of how D3.js can be applied to real-world problems and scenarios. By exploring these examples, users can learn best practices and techniques for creating effective data visualizations that communicate insights and drive decision-making.\u003cbr\u003e\u003cbr\u003eIn addition to its industry-specific case-based examples, D3.js also offers a comprehensive guide on visual implementation. This guide covers topics such as data preparation, selection, transformation, and visualization, providing users with a step-by-step process for creating stunning data visualizations using D3.js. Whether users are new to data visualization or have experience with other libraries, this guide is designed to help them leverage the full potential of D3.js and create visually appealing and informative charts, graphs, and maps.\u003cbr\u003e\u003cbr\u003eOne of the key aspects of writing clean and maintainable code with D3.js is its emphasis on modularity and reusability. D3.js follows:\u003cbr\u003e\u003cbr\u003eEncourages the use of modular components and functions, which makes it easier to organize and reuse code.\u003cbr\u003e\u003cbr\u003eProvides a rich set of built-in functions and operators that can be combined to create complex visualizations.\u003cbr\u003e\u003cbr\u003eOffers a well-documented API that allows users to extend the functionality of D3.js and create custom visualizations.\u003cbr\u003e\u003cbr\u003eBy following these principles, users can write code that is more efficient, scalable, and easier to understand and maintain. This not only improves the development process but also ensures that data visualizations can be updated and modified over time without significant effort.\u003cbr\u003e\u003cbr\u003eIn conclusion, D3.js is a powerful data visualization library that offers a wide range of features and tools for creating interactive and visually stunning charts, graphs, and maps. Its industry-specific case-based examples, comprehensive guide on visual implementation, and emphasis on clean and maintainable code make it an invaluable tool for data scientists, analysts, and developers. Whether users are new to data visualization or have experience with other libraries, D3.js is a versatile and powerful tool that can help them unlock the full potential of their data and communicate insights effectively.\u003c\/p\u003e\u003cp\u003e\u003cstrong\u003eWeight\u003c\/strong\u003e: 330g\u003cbr\u003e\u003cstrong\u003eDimension\u003c\/strong\u003e: 151 x 230 x 15 (mm)\u003cbr\u003e\u003cstrong\u003eISBN-13\u003c\/strong\u003e: 9781032411705\u003c\/p\u003e","brand":"Shulph Ink","offers":[{"title":"Paperback \/ softback","offer_id":44528853188858,"sku":"9781032411705","price":38.07,"currency_code":"GBP","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0522\/4297\/2845\/products\/1692379450712_book.jpg?v=1693481659","url":"https:\/\/shulphink.com\/products\/conquering-javascript-d3js-9781032411705","provider":"Shulph Ink","version":"1.0","type":"link"}